LHC quashes FIRs against 350 industrial units

byCustoms Today ReportandSaleem Jadon
21/09/2013
in Lahore, Latest News
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

LAHORE: A division bench of the Lahore High Court has quashed all the FIRs registered against more than 350 industrial units and also stayed criminal proceedings initiated by the Sales Tax Department.

The bench held that the registration of cases and criminal proceedings against industrial units by the department were illegal and void as it had taken this action without adjudication and proper inquiry.
